Web3 feb. 2024 · February 3, 2024. A Canadian first: Innovative biopsy procedure for prostate cancer. North York General Hospital (NYGH) has recently started using a new biopsy procedure to test for prostate cancer that significantly reduces the chance of developing an infection. Called a transperineal biopsy (TP), it significantly reduces the risk of serious ... WebIntroduction. A biopsy of the prostate is a surgical procedure in which (usually) several thin cylindrical “cores” of prostate tissue are removed from the prostate for microscopic examination by a pathologist. Web25 okt. 2024 · The newer transperineal method takes an additional 5 to 10 minutes but offers significant benefits for patients in a more comfortable setting and, more importantly, a more accurate sampling of the prostate. The program is one of the first in Florida to utilize this method for prostate cancer biopsy.
